Now click on the Terminal window and press, On your Mac, select a disk, folder, or file, then choose. Enter this command in Terminal, then press the Enter key: Change $USER with the currently logged-in user and /path/to/directory with the path to where you want to write to. Upon entering your admin password, a list with a Terminal checkbox appears. Here are some examples of commands: If none of the aforementioned fixes worked, try changing the ownership of the directory to your username. Step 3. If youre trying to run an application, make sure that the program command is valid and installed on your computer. You can enter this command in Terminal, then press Enter: chown -R $USER:$USER /path/to/directory. This is kind of obvious, but did you repair permissions on the drive yet? $ touch ./onlyroot.txt $ sudo chown root:root ./onlyroot.txt $ sudo bash -c "whoami | tee who.txt" > onlyroot.txt bash: onlyroot.txt: Permission denied In the test above the whoami | tee who.txt was going to create a file named who.txt containing the word "root". Unauthorized full disc access in terminal windows may also result in prohibited operation. 1. It may not display this or other websites correctly. How to Fix Error Code 0xA00F429F on Windows 10/11, Error Copying File or Folder: The Requested Value Cannot Be Determined. If the information in Sharing & Permissions isn't visible, click the arrow next to Sharing & Permissions. Most of the reports say that the error appears when they are trying to open the file installer via Terminal. Save my name, email, and website in this browser for the next time I comment. You can also try to force a command that requires administrator permission using sudo. There are very common things that deliver permission-denied issues such as an app that couldn't use the camera, or microphone, being unable to save files, can't share your screen with others, and many more. The reason why you encounter a permission denied error is that you're not an administrator, or because the owner of the file used chmod to lock the file. So heres a tip for you: Download CleanMyMac to quickly solve some of the issues mentioned in this article. He also rips off an arm to use as a sword. After entering the diskutil command, if Terminal says that permissions It's left the sudoers in bad shape. Start up in Recovery mode by holding Command-R. Once in Recovery mode, open Terminal from the Utilities menu. I just got error when I tried to repair it. To unlock the file or folder, Control-click the item, select Get Info, and clear the box next to Locked. It could be because you do not have administrator privileges or because the creator of the file used chmod to lock the file. Problem solved? . Connect and share knowledge within a single location that is structured and easy to search. Click on the arrows next to Terminal and choose Reset. chown root:wheel /etc/sudoers chown: /etc/sudoers: Operation not permitted. Did the drapes in old theatres actually say "ASBESTOS" on them? On your Mac device, choose a folder or directory. Now, click the padlock on the window's lower left side and type your user password. Step 3. If the issue started after changing the permissions of items in your Click the lock icon to unlock it. If that is the case, try configuring the .zshrc file. nouchg ~ then enter the diskutil command again. Here are other solutions you can try: Sometimes, the Zsh permission denied error can be resolved by trying to improve your existing Terminal app. Gain permission for filesFull steps, Method 2. Home If the information is not available, hit the arrow. What should I follow, if two altimeters show different altitudes? Fix Zsh Permission Denied Error in Mac Terminal, 1. 2 - Use the search bar to locate the Terminal. He always keeps an eye on new releases and loves various electronic products. Find centralized, trusted content and collaborate around the technologies you use most. We'll show you both ways below. Does a password policy with a restriction of repeated characters increase security? Usually, you can resolve the issue by modifying the permissions or ownership. Drag the file or the folder into the terminal window. that can cause system issues or slow performance. Step by Step guide to resolve the problem: and check if the output on terminal includes this line. Let's share the happiness with others. First, click the Apple logo in the top-left corner and choose System Preferences from the drop-down menu. Unexpected uint64 behaviour 0xFFFF'FFFF'FFFF'FFFF - 1 = 0? Opening a file on a Mac is a straightforward process you can either double-click it or use the Terminal to navigate to the file location and open it with a command. Writer and blogger at MacPaw, curious just about everything. 1) Open Terminal (in Utilities). Here, type terminal and double-click on the search result. If you're trying to run an application, make sure that the program command is valid and installed on your computer. Now, please check your email. So you're trying to pirate software with a keygen? How to Make a Black glass pass light through it? 4. Follow the steps below to check your permissions. Once done,restart your Macand check out the below troubleshooting guide. ext. You just need to double-click on it and voila! Print Email. Type the following command in Terminal, then hit the Enter key: You should replace $USER with the user who is currently logged in and /path/to/directory with the path to the location you want to write to. Alternatively, you can use the following command to unlock an item via the Terminal itself: If the "zsh: permission denied" error occurs while opening an SH (shell script) file in the macOS Terminal, it's likely that it does not have "execute" permissions. Mark all the radio buttons that are showing App Store and identified developers. You can then customize your terminal by running the open ~/.zshrc command. If you still cant fix the issue, seek help from a Mac expert. Is there a generic term for these trajectories? Share your stories in the comments below! Change your current Terminal apps theme by using the ZSH_THEME=theme_name command. It can occur with sudo commands or even bash commands. This will automatically append the file's location to the existing command. Throughout her 3 years of experience, Jessica has written many informative and instructional articles in data recovery, data security, and disk management to help a lot of readers secure their important documents and take the best advantage of their devices. Step 2. That can be changed according to the requirement. Press Return. The Sudo command is straightforward but strong enough to let you run almost any command from the Terminal. You can usually fix it by changing permissions or re-assigning ownership. If the Lock button at the bottom of the window shows a closed lock lock , click the lock and enter an administrator name and password. But before you can proceed with that, you have to be familiar with how to enter a command. What risks are you taking when "signing in with Google"? Just like what the name says, this is a permission error that prevents Mac users from opening a file using commands. Step 4. With the help of this error, no other file or the directory mentioned in it is not going to open. So, if you have encountered the Mac permission denied problem, then usesudo commands in Terminal. If you require administrator access, you can force that command with sudo. If you're new to command-line interpreters, feel free to check our beginner's guide to the Mac Terminal and commands cheat sheet for help. How do I print colored text to the terminal? Here are some of the most typical: The permission denied error is most likely to appear when installing a program or changing a locked file. Change the Ownership of the Directory Method 4. Type the following command, then press " Enter ": diskutil resetUserPermissions / `id -u` Some users may need to run the command with "sudo" in front of it: sudo diskutil resetUserPermissions / `id -u` The system will then verify and repair permissions. To unlock the file or folder, Control -click the item, select Get Info, and clear the box next to Locked. Share Improve this answer Follow edited Jan 4, 2016 at 3:37 Giacomo1968 52.2k 18 162 211 answered May 25, 2012 at 3:31 Danny 331 1 3 For the benefit of the other readers, if there is anything else you would like to add that we havent already covered, kindly do so in the comments section. Below are some ways to do so: Method 1: Assign permissions to users and groups On your Mac, select a disk, folder, or file, then choose File > Get Info. Did the Golden Gate Bridge 'flatten' under the weight of 300,000 people in 1987? Here are some of the most typical: 1 Why Are You Receiving The Permission Denied Error In the Terminal?1.1 The File Is Locked1.2 Incorrect chmod X or System Command1.3 The Files Permissions Arent Sufficient2 Fix Zsh Permission Denied Error in Mac Terminal2.1 1. Select Reset by clicking on the arrows next to Terminal. 3. Step 4. Close the Terminal Preferences window. The most common ones are as follows: You will most likely encounter the Permission Denied error if you are trying to install a program or modify a file that is locked. Here are sample commands: You will be prompted to enter your password if this is your first time using the sudo command. I'm trying to write a command on mac terminal using the root, but it shows me that the permission denied, when I use the sudo it shows that the command not found, To avoid permission denied prompt, type this command and continue. Several reasonssuch as insufficient permissions and ownership issuesoften cause that. home folder, reset permissions: Paste or type this command in Terminal, then press Return: On U.S. keyboards, the ` character is just above the Tab key. To get started, all you need is a basic understanding of its functions and commands, which you can enter into the command line. Give the Terminal Full Access to the Disk, 5. This error sometimes occurs when a user tries to use a useless system command. Zsh Permission Denied Error For the benefit of the other readers, if there is anything else you would like to add that we havent already covered, kindly do so in the comments section. Apply permissions to all items in a folder or a disk On your Mac, select a folder or disk, then choose File > Get Info. This command should allow you to execute almost any command from the Terminal. 1700, Tianfu Avenue North, High-tech Zone. One way to fix that is to reset the app. command+S during boot Or maybe you can do the same by booting on the recovery partition. Best iPhone Game Updates: Plants vs Zombies 2, Bacon The Game, Star Traders: Frontiers, and More, Marvel Snap Rocks Out to the Greatest Hits of the Guardians of the Galaxy in the Latest Season, Horror Mystery-Adventure Paranormasight: The Seven Mysteries of Honjo Is Discounted for a Limited Time Alongside Other Square Enix Games, SwitchArcade Round-Up: Nuclear Blaze, Varney Lake, Fran Bow, Plus Todays Other Releases and Sales, Voice of Cards: The Forsaken Maiden Review A Good Starting Point, Vampire Survivors Being Adapted Into Premium Animated TV Series by Story Kitchen and Poncle, Dead Cells Clean Cut Update Out Now on PC Bringing In Two New Weapons, Speedrun Mode, and More. For this, you need to configure permissions by opening the file using the chmod +x ~/.zshrc command. If you are having trouble starting a program, check to see if it is using the command of the program you are trying to start. Start up in recovery mode (Cmd+R during boot up), Disk Utilities > Select Macintosh HD, and Mount. 4. First, check your files permissions and try changing ownership with the chown command. Step 1. The permission error is a sign that your command is trying to write to a directory that your user account does not own. From Apple KB - Resolve issues caused by changing the permissions of items in your home folder Reset permissions If the issue started after changing the permissions of items in your home folder, reset permissions: To let CleanMyMac X reset default Mac apps, go to CleanMyMac X Preferences. Are you still seeing the Zsh permission denied error? To change permissions in Terminal, do the following: If changing permissions didn't fix the problem, try changing the ownership of the directory to your username. When the file is dragged to the Terminal window, the Permission Denied error pops up. Once you install this framework, you will have access to hundreds of powerful plugins and neat themes. Terminal is an app that lives in the Utilities folder inside Applications. Permission-denied errors could also occur from incorrectly entered commands. What's the cheapest way to buy out a sibling's share of our parents house if I have no cash and want to pay less than the appraised value? How to Fix Zsh Permission Denied in Mac Terminal? App permission denied- The Don't Allow option is chosen, whichis rejected at the time of using a feature related to the Application. Select Privacy from the Privacy and Security menu.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site. Type the command below and add a space after the final character, but dont hit the Enter button. This will demonstrate whether you are authorized to add to or edit the file. 1) Open the terminal and enter below command ex: sudo chown iMac ~/.bash_profile. What differentiates living as mere roommates from living in a marriage-like relationship? 5 Ways to Perform Control+Alt+Delete, Fix Sorry, No Manipulations With Clipboard Allowed on macOS. Choose any fileor a folder present on the disk and then get info of that on the selected one. Open Terminal or iTerm and type "chmod -R 755 " and drag the .app into the window, which will bring the full path into Terminal or iTerm. Solution 2: Grant the Terminal with Full Disk Permission. To learn more, see our tips on writing great answers. Another reason the macOS terminals permission is denied could be that the terminal does not fully access the disc. Also, it tells you how to access usr folder on Mac. It would also clean up your system to make your processes run smoothly. Step 4. According to several reports, the Permission Denied error can also happen even when the file is being opened in root. Step 3. Please review EULA and Privacy Policy. What were the most popular text editors for MS-DOS in the 1980s? But to help her do it all by yourself, we've gathered our best ideas and solutions below. Control+Click your user account name from the list of users. Open Utilities or the Mac Dock to launch Terminal.Type the command below and add a space after the final character, but dont hit the Enter button.Drop the file you want to open into the Terminal window by dragging it there. If it failed again, it's also a good choice when you need to recover Trash on Macor recover unsaved Word documents. Solution 5: Give Permissions to Users and Groups. Take ownership of the directory with the chown command before attempting to write to it. So you would have found the solution if you were trying to fix Zsh Permission Denied in Terminal on macOS Ventura or Monterey. However, the file wont be moved. It is designed and built on top of bash - macOS' default shell and it covers some features of ksh and tcsh. This site is not affiliated with or endorsed by Apple Inc. in any way. You can tell which shell Terminal is running by looking at the top of any Terminal window. Select Macintosh HD from the left sidebar menu. Additionally, depending on the Mac update, some of you might need assistance finding Terminal in the list. Its possible that the Terminal itself is having issues, and that is why you are getting a permission denied error. If it's not working try to start in single user mode maybe? Extracting arguments from a list of function calls. If your connection failed and you're using a remote URL with your GitHub username, you can change the remote URL to use the "git" user. Special offer. For the changes to take effect, close the Terminal window. As a result, if youve encountered the Mac permission denied error, use sudo commands in Terminal. The all-round problem fixer available Mac.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. Before fixing the Zsh permission denied error in Mac, make copies of any relevant files you have. He excels in troubleshooting errors and resolving Windows issues for gaming and work purposes. Keep reading and learn more about how to fix permission denied on Mac. What is Wario dropping at the end of Super Mario Land 2 and why? Interpreting non-statistically significant results: Do we have "no evidence" or "insufficient evidence" to reject the null? I do have the access to view and eidt, and it has been made executable by chmod u+x also, gatekeeper has been disabled (MacOSX Sierra), but I still get the permission denied message. DO NOT press. According to several reports, the "Zsh: Permission denied" error can also happen even when the file is being opened in the root. Follow the steps below to fix the macOS permission denied: Cedric Grantham is one of the senior editors of EaseUS who lives and works in Chengdu, China. Does a password policy with a restriction of repeated characters increase security? Use the chmod command to change the permissions of the file or directory. Change [username] to your username and [directorypath] to the path to the directory whose ownership you want to change in the steps below. Check the File Permissions Using Terminal on Mac, 2. Check the File Permissions Using Terminal on Mac2.2 2. Not the answer you're looking for? Unauthorized full disc access in terminal windows may also result in prohibited operation. What were the poems other than those by Donne in the Melford Hall manuscript? He creates content that educates and helps users with their tech-related questions. Your home folder opens. However, this can also happen with any other file. This app is located in the Utilities folder under Applications. Share with more people about this helpful guide! Click "Search for lost files" to start scanning. Open CleanMyMac X, then select Uninstaller from the sidebar on the left.To find Terminal, use the search bar.When the file size is opened, click the arrow.Now, check the circles next to the Preferences and Supporting Files.Select Reset by clicking on the arrows next to Terminal.Hit the Reset button. After that, the user will see a lock symbol to click on and enter the admin password and username to unlock it. Permissions for the file or folder will be changed to read, write, and execute. Type the following command in Terminal, then hit the Enter key: While some may find it challenging to use, others find it incredibly convenient. This is not able to fix all types of denied errors that come directly, but only an option you can try after trying all possible methods. Double-click afile to preview it. Here are the instructions to access your system preferences in order to fix the app permissions. Home Mac How to Fix Permission Denied in Terminal Mac. When you login first time using a Social Login button, we collect your account public profile information shared by Social Login provider, based on your privacy settings. The permission denied error is most likely to appear when installing a program or changing a locked file. And using the helpful app CleanMyMac X is the simplest method for doing that. Its possible that the Terminal itself is having issues, and that is why you are getting a permission denied error. JavaScript is disabled. 308, 3/F, Unit 1, Building 6, No. We'll show you both ways below. Franais Did the drapes in old theatres actually say "ASBESTOS" on them? It will be very simple to fix and will help to clarify why and how it occurs. Most of the reports say that the error appears when they are trying to open the file installer via Terminal. Once you get the hang of it, you can delve into more advanced commands and explore a wide range of features to accomplish more complex tasks, feeling like a hacker in a spy movie. If you are still getting the Zsh permission denied error on your Mac while trying to open a file on macOS Catalina or other versions, fret not. If not, note this thing in your mind, you will need it later. Browse other questions tagged.
How To Clean Frying Oil With Cornstarch, Beth Israel Hospital Boston Address, 1984 To 1988 Monte Carlo Ss For Sale, Richard Haynes Bramty Brother, En Que Tiempo Se Ve Resultados De Un Endulzamiento, Articles H